Citizens Energy Corporation
Citizens Energy Corporation is a non-profit organization that assist eligible household who have a financial hardship and need help paying their heating bills. There are no citizenship requirements. The company has made the move from only providing crude oil and has expanded into renewable energy and transmission projects while still focusing on assisting low-income households.
Their program Joe-4-Sun MA is available to low-income Massachusetts residents who receive and Eversource or National Grid electric bills. Joe-4-Sun RAP is available to Massachusetts residents who belong to specific communities in the state such as members of the Mashpee or Aquinnah Wampanoag Tribes.
